How to build a partner enablement content maintenance schedule that ensures sales, technical, and marketing materials remain accurate for SaaS resellers.

In complex SaaS ecosystems, partner enablement hinges on a living content framework that stays current despite product updates, pricing shifts, and strategic pivots. Design begins with a clear ownership model that assigns responsibility for each content category to a primary owner and a rotating reviewer cohort. Establish a centralized repository that supports versioning, tagging, and change history so teams can trace why updates occurred and who approved them. This foundation reduces misalignment between sales pitches, deployment guides, and marketing collateral. It also creates a shared language for partners, making communications predictable and trustworthy across channels and regions.
A robust schedule blends cadence with flexibility, recognizing that some updates are urgent while others follow a quarterly rhythm. Start with a quarterly content health check that evaluates coverage, accuracy, and relevance for sales, onboarding, and demand generation. Incorporate monthly micro-audits focused on high-variance areas like feature releases, pricing tiers, and integration capabilities. Embed a policy for urgent patches that bypasses standard cycles when critical bug fixes, security notices, or major product changes arise. Finally, document escalation paths so partners receive timely alerts and guidance when content gaps emerge or errors are discovered.
Create a repeatable, transparent update process with clear roles.
To operationalize accountability, appoint a content steward for each material type—sales decks, technical implementation guides, and marketing one-pagers. This role is responsible for initial creation, periodic validation, and timely revision when upstream product information shifts. Pair stewards with cross-functional editors drawn from product management, engineering, and field sales. The editor network should meet quarterly to review new requirements, test navigability, and confirm consistency across assets. A transparent approval trail helps prevent backslides where a later update contradicts earlier claims. Regular cross-training ensures editors understand partner use cases and the channels through which materials are consumed.

The maintenance schedule should cover the most common content frictions: misalignment between product reality and messaging, outdated installation steps, and stale pricing references. Build lightweight templates that guide updates without forcing overhauls. For each asset, record metadata including version, effective date, audience, language variants, and distribution lists. Use automated checks where possible, such as price rule validators and feature flag verifications, to surface discrepancies early. Schedule quarterly content audits, monthly changelog updates, and ad-hoc hotfix rounds for time-sensitive adjustments. This approach keeps partners confident that what they receive reflects current capabilities and supported integrations.
Build resilient workflows that scale across teams and regions.
A strong governance model is essential. Define minimum quality criteria for every asset: accuracy, completeness, clarity, and accessibility. Build quick-reference checklists for authors and reviewers to ensure consistency and to reduce back-and-forth during approvals. Integrate partner feedback loops so reseller teams can flag confusing sections, missing steps, or divergent terminology. Track these inputs in a shared backlog that feeds the next cycle. Publish a public-facing changelog that highlights what changed, why it changed, and when the change takes effect. Ensuring visibility reduces frustration and accelerates adoption across partner networks.

Technology choices matter as much as process. Invest in a content management system that supports role-based access, review workflows, and localization. Implement a robust search index with tag-based filtering so partners can quickly locate the exact asset they need, whether they are in North America or a multilingual market. Enable in-context documentation linking, so sales reps can click from a slide to a deployment guide, then to a troubleshooting article. Establish an API-backed connection to release calendars and product roadmaps, ensuring that every update is synchronized with product milestones and marketing campaigns.

Training is a critical enabler of long-term accuracy. Onboarding for new partner managers should include a crash course on the maintenance schedule, tooling, and review rituals. Regular refresher sessions help existing teams stay aligned with evolving policies and nomenclature. Use practical exercises that simulate real-world updates—such as a hypothetical feature launch or a price change—to test the end-to-end flow from creation to distribution. Document lessons learned after each cycle and incorporate them into playbooks. A culture that treats maintenance as a shared responsibility reduces the risk of drift and improves partner trust in the ecosystem.
Metrics anchor continuous improvement. Define a small set of leading indicators, such as update cycle adherence, time-to-publish for new assets, and rate of flagged errors by partner teams. Track impact on reseller performance, like win rates and cycle times, to validate that the maintenance schedule delivers tangible business value. Build dashboards that summarize asset health, reviewer load, and content usage across regions. Use quarterly reviews to interpret metrics, identify bottlenecks, and reallocate resources to the most impactful areas. This data-driven discipline sustains momentum and drives ongoing refinements.

Communication with resellers must be precise and timely. Create a clear notification protocol that preserves context—what changed, why, and who approved it. Use partner-ready summaries that translate technical details into practical implications for sales and deployment. Include direct links to affected assets, timelines for rollout, and any required actions for partners. Maintain a dedicated channel for urgent updates that avoids clutter in routine communications. Regularly publish success stories and case studies that demonstrate how refreshed materials enabled smoother deployments and quicker value realization for customers.
Collaboration across departments is the backbone of reliability. Schedule joint content reviews with product, engineering, and marketing on a rotating basis to ensure broad visibility and buy-in. Encourage constructive feedback cycles that reward fast, accurate corrections over perfect initial drafts. Create a living glossary to standardize terms and reduce misinterpretation across languages and markets. By weaving together insights from multiple functions, the schedule stays attuned to real-world partner needs and keeps messaging consistent with the product narrative.
As the calendar turns, continuity hinges on disciplined planning. Start each cycle with a distillation of what changed in the product suite, pricing, and support options. Then map those changes to the exact assets impacted, establishing clear owners and due dates. Use prerelease gates to test updates in controlled partner cohorts, gathering feedback before general distribution. Maintain a robust rollback path for problematic updates, ensuring partners can return to known-good states quickly. Close the loop with a retrospective that captures wins, gaps, and concrete improvement actions for the next iteration.
Finally, cultivate a partner-enabled culture that values accuracy as a strategic asset. Communicate the bigger purpose of the maintenance schedule: reducing friction for resellers, accelerating time-to-value for customers, and protecting the integrity of your brand. Recognize teams and individuals who contribute high-quality updates, and share feedback that reinforces best practices. Over time, the combined discipline of governance, tooling, and collaborative reviews yields a resilient enablement engine. When partners experience consistent, reliable materials, they become more confident ambassadors and more effective sellers for your SaaS platform.
